CMS data shows Savoy Care Center earning a D grade with a score of 53/100, placing it below most facilities in Louisiana. Prospective residents and families should carefully review the specific areas of concern detailed below.
With 3.33 total nurse hours per resident per day, Savoy Care Center falls below the national average of 3.8 hours. Families may want to ask about staffing levels during any facility visit.
Recent inspections identified 24 deficiencies at Savoy Care Center. While none were classified as the most serious level, families should review the detailed inspection history below.

🏥 Staffing Details
| Staff Type | Hours/Resident/Day | National Avg | Comparison |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Nursing | 3.33 | 3.8 | Below Average |
| Registered Nurses (RN) | 0.12 | 0.7 | Below Average |
| Licensed Practical Nurses (LPN) | 0.93 | 0.7 | Above Average |
| Certified Nursing Assistants (CNA) | 2.28 | 2.4 | Average |
| Weekend Total Nursing | 2.96 | 3.8 | Below Average |
| Weekend RN Hours | 0.13 | 0.7 | Below Average |

📊 Resident Outcome Measures
Based on CMS quality measure data. Lower percentages are better for most metrics.
| Measure | This Facility | Nat'l Avg |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Residents with pressure ulcers | 6.0% | 4.5% | Worse |
| Falls with major injury | 3.4% | 3.0% | Worse |
| On antipsychotic medication | 43.9% | 14.5% | Worse |
| Urinary tract infections | 5.3% | 2.5% | Worse |
| ADL decline (daily activities) | 27.4% | 14.0% | Worse |
| Excessive weight loss | 12.8% | 7.5% | Worse |
| New/worsened incontinence | 32.7% | 45.0% | Better |
How This Grade Was Calculated
This facility's grade of D is based on a score of 53 out of 100, calculated from official CMS Nursing Home Compare data:
- Overall CMS Rating: 3★ → 24 pts (max 40)
- Health Inspection Rating: 3★ → 15 pts (max 25)
- Staffing Rating: 2★ → 8 pts (max 20)
- Quality Measures Rating: 2★ → 6 pts (max 15)
Grades: A=85+, B=70–84, C=55–69, D=40–54, F=below 40
